Top Schools in Business Economics
Seton Hall University tops our 2026 ranking of the best business economics schools. This large private not-for-profit university is located in the suburb of South Orange. The six-year graduation rate is 70%. Seton Hall University awarded about 17 business economics degrees in the most recent data year. Business Economics graduates of Seton Hall University earn a median of $66,877 early in their careers. Students borrow a median of $21,522 to complete this degree.

The ranking above is published by College Factual (MF_RANKING_2025), 2026 edition. Schools are scored on a blend of student outcomes (graduation rate, post-graduation earnings), affordability, and program focus, drawn primarily from the U.S. Department of Education (IPEDS and College Scorecard).
